linux怎么查看数据库是否启动命令

worktile 其他 525

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要查看数据库是否启动,可以使用以下命令:

    1. 对于MySQL数据库,可以使用以下命令:

    “`shell
    sudo service mysql status
    “`

    或者,

    “`shell
    sudo systemctl status mysql
    “`

    如果数据库正在运行,将显示”active (running)”的状态。

    2. 对于PostgreSQL数据库,可以使用以下命令:

    “`shell
    sudo service postgresql status
    “`

    或者,

    “`shell
    sudo systemctl status postgresql
    “`

    同样,如果数据库正在运行,将显示”active (running)”的状态。

    3. 对于Oracle数据库,可以使用以下命令:

    “`shell
    sudo systemctl status oracle
    “`

    或者,

    “`shell
    sudo service oracle status
    “`

    同样,如果数据库正在运行,将显示”active (running)”的状态。

    4. 对于SQLite数据库,可以使用以下命令:

    “`shell
    ps aux | grep -i sqlite
    “`

    如果有正在运行的SQLite进程,将显示相关的信息。

    以上是常见的几种数据库的查看启动状态的命令,根据所使用的具体数据库类型,选择相应的命令进行查询即可。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ux系统中,可以通过以下几种方法来查看数据库是否启动。

    1. 使用命令行工具检查系统服务状态:
    使用以下命令检查数据库服务的状态:
    “`
    service <数据库服务名称> status
    “`
    例如,对于MySQL数据库服务,可以使用以下命令检查其状态:
    “`
    service mysql status
    “`

    2. 使用操作系统的进程管理工具:
    使用以下命令查看所有正在运行的进程:
    “`
    ps -ef | grep <数据库进程关键字>
    “`
    例如,对于MySQL数据库,可以使用以下命令:
    “`
    ps -ef | grep mysql
    “`

    3. 使用数据库自带的命令行工具:
    某些数据库提供了自带的命令行工具,可以使用这些工具来检查数据库服务的状态。
    对于MySQL数据库,可以使用以下命令来连接数据库服务器并检查其状态:
    “`
    mysql -u <用户名> -p
    SHOW STATUS;
    “`

    4. 检查数据库日志文件:
    数据库通常会将运行时日志记录在特定的日志文件中。通过查看数据库日志文件,可以了解数据库的运行状态和任何可能的错误信息。
    日志文件的位置和名称取决于所使用的数据库软件和配置。一般来说,可以在数据库的配置文件中找到日志文件的位置。
    对于MySQL数据库,可以在MySQL的配置文件(my.cnf)中找到日志文件的位置。

    5. 使用系统监控工具:
    Linux系统提供了多种监控工具,可以用于检查数据库服务的运行状态。这些工具可以提供详细的系统指标、进程状态和运行日志等信息,帮助用户判断数据库是否正常启动。
    一些常用的系统监控工具包括top、htop、nmon等。可以使用这些工具检查数据库的CPU和内存使用情况,以及数据库进程是否在运行中。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要查看Linux中数据库是否启动,可以使用以下方法:

    1. 使用命令查看数据库服务的运行状态

    在Linux中,可以使用`systemctl`命令来查看系统服务的状态。不同的数据库可能有不同的服务名和命令,下面以MySQL和MongoDB为例:

    – MySQL

    “`
    systemctl status mysql
    “`

    – MongoDB

    “`
    systemctl status mongod
    “`

    运行以上命令后,会显示数据库服务的状态信息,包括是否正在运行。

    2. 检查数据库进程是否在运行

    数据库启动时,会有相应的进程在系统中运行。可以使用`ps`命令来检查指定数据库的进程是否在运行。以下是一些常见数据库的进程命令:

    – MySQL

    “`
    ps -ef | grep mysqld
    “`

    – MongoDB

    “`
    ps -ef | grep mongod
    “`

    运行以上命令后,如果返回包含数据库进程的行数大于0,则表示数据库正在运行。

    3. 登录数据库客户端查看连接状态

    登录到数据库客户端,可以使用相应的命令来查看数据库的连接状态。以下是一些常见数据库的登录命令:

    – MySQL

    “`
    mysql -u username -p
    “`

    登录到MySQL客户端后,可以使用以下命令查看连接状态:

    “`
    show processlist;
    “`

    – PostgreSQL

    “`
    psql -U username -d dbname
    “`

    登录到PostgreSQL客户端后,可以使用以下命令查看连接状态:

    “`
    select * from pg_stat_activity;
    “`

    – MongoDB

    “`
    mongo
    “`

    登录到MongoDB客户端后,可以使用以下命令查看连接状态:

    “`
    db.currentOp();
    “`

    以上是一些常见的方法,具体的查看命令可能会因数据库的不同而有所差异。可以根据具体的数据库类型和版本,参考相应的文档来查看数据库的启动状态。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部